Situated in northern Israel, Kfar Giladi Quarries (KGQ), faces a catastrophe: the national market is in downturn; the administration budget for the infrastructure progress and building, on which the corporation depends, has been reduced; transport and distribution problems limit its capability to export (or import) inexpensive raw materials; and there's increasing competition in the industry.

Kfar Giladi Quarries Crisis During an Economic Recession Case Study Solution

The company had lately broken up its partnership with Malibu Israel Company Ltd., an international firm that had given it right of entry to the middle part of Israel where most transportation and construction jobs and investments are positioned. The consequence has been loss in company as well as a negative cash flow. The case permit pupils to practice basic tools for strategic planning and enables supervision to businesses undecided over a recovery program, particularly during an economic downturn; firms in a reorganization period after separation from a partner; and/or businesses which must change their direction paradigm.
